According to the public record, Flat C, 26, Cambridge Road, Ilford is a leasehold apartment.
By comparing it to neighbours, we estimate that it is a period apartment with 538 ft2 of internal area.
Apartments of this size in this area normally have 2 bedrooms.
Based on available information, and assuming reasonable condition, the estimated sale value for Flat C, 26, Cambridge Road, Ilford is £236,696 and the estimated rental value is £1,535 per month.
The apartment is within 26, Cambridge Road, Ilford, IG3.
Cambridge Road, Ilford, IG3 is located in the borough of Redbridge within the IG3 postal district.
Flat C, 26, Cambridge Road, Ilford has a single entry in the Land Registry from September 2007 and no records in the EPC database.

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If Flat C, 26, Cambridge Road, Ilford is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£248,531 and a rental value of £1,612 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£220,127 and a rental value of £1,428 per month.
Over the last 12 months the sale value of Flat C 26 Cambridge Road Ilford has decreased by an estimated £5,349 (2.3%) and its rental value has increased by an estimated £42 per month (2.8%), giving an expected gross yield of 7.8%.
According to HM Land Registry, Flat C, 26, Cambridge Road, Ilford was last sold on 18th September 2007 for £130,000 and was recorded as a leasehold flat.
The property has only had this single sale since 1995.
